Slow Cooker Ham 3 Recipe

Submitted by RecipeTips.com
Slow cooked ham that is moist and flavorful without any fuss. You won't want to go bake to baking your ham in the oven after trying this simple but delicious slow cooked ham recipe.
Slow Cooker Ham 3 Recipe
Ingredients
  • 1 1/2 cups light brown sugar (divided)
  • 5 pounds whole, rump, shank or spiral slice ham (ready to cook)
  • 1 can pineapple slices (optional)
Directions
In a large slow cooker, spread about 1 cup light brown sugar on the bottom of crock. Rub the remaining brown sugar on top of ham. If using pineapple slices, add to top of ham and secure with toothpicks. You can add some of or all of the left over pineapple juice to crockpot if you wish. Cover and cook on low for 5-8 hours or until center portion of ham reaches 160-degrees. Make sure thermometer does not touch bone. Slice and serve. Don't worry about not adding water; it will create its own juices. If using spiral slice, check and baste often. It will cook somewhat faster than other varieties of ham, since it's already sliced.

Make-Ahead Mashed Potato Bake Recipe

Submitted by RecipeTips.com
A rich and delicious mashed potato dish that can be made a day ahead of baking it. This recipe is nice during the busy holiday time because you can get them made up the day before and just have to bake them the day you are ready to serve them. They are also great to eat on their own or with gravy.
Make-Ahead Mashed Potato Bake Recipe
PREP: 40 minutes
COOK: 45 minutes
Servings:
Change Servings
Ingredients
  • 12 potatoes - medium
  • 8 ounces cream cheese
  • 1 cup sour cream
  • 1/4 cup milk
  • 1 tablespoon butter or margarine
  • 1 tablespoon parsley flakes
  • 1 teaspoon garlic salt
  • 1 tablespoon butter or margarine
  • 1/4 teaspoon paprika
Directions
  • Peel and quarter the potatoes. Boil until tender; drain.
  • In a large mixing bowl, beat the potatoes until fairly well mashed. Add the cream cheese, sour cream, milk, butter, parsley flakes, and garlic salt; beat until smooth and fluffy.
  • Grease a 9 x 13 baking dish; spoon the mashed potatoes into it and spread out evenly. Dab a tablespoon of butter over the top and sprinkle with the paprika.
  • Cover with plastic wrap and refrigerate until ready to bake. When ready to bake, place in an oven preheated to 350 degrees F, uncovered. Bake for 40 to 45 minutes or until thoroughly heated.

Caramelized Sweet Potatoes Recipe

Submitted by RecipeTips.com
The sauce on these sweet potatoes have a caramel flavor and texture, making this potato dish extra sweet and delicious. This is sure to be one of your favorite ways to enjoy sweet potatoes.
Caramelized Sweet Potatoes Recipe
PREP: 30 minutes
COOK: 45 minutes
Container: 9 x 13 baking dish
Ingredients
  • 6 sweet potatoes (medium)
  • 1 teaspoon Salt
  • 1 cup Brown Sugar
  • 2 tablespoons butter
  • 1/2 package mini marshmallows (10 oz. pkg.)
  • 1 cup half & half (or milk)
  • 1/2 cup chopped pecans
  • 3 tablespoons flour
Directions
  • Peel the sweet potatoes and cut into large pieces. Boil until tender.
  • Arrange in greased 9 x 13 baking dish.
  • Mix salt, flour and sugar; pour mixture over sweet potatoes. Dot with butter.
  • Add marshmallows and pecans. Pour milk or cream over the top of all.
  • Bake at 350° for 45 to 50 minutes.

Tomato and Basil Soup Recipe

Submitted by RecipeTips.com
A warm tomato soup that has a hint of spice in the background from the chili flakes. Perfect served with grilled cheese.
Tomato and Basil Soup Recipe
PREP: 45 minutes
COOK: 30 minutes
READY IN: 1.25 hours
Servings:
Change Servings
Ingredients
  • 5 Roma tomatoes
  • 3 tablespoons olive oil, divided
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on pepper
  • 2 tablespoons butter
  • 1 onion, chopped
  • 1 teaspoon garlic, minced
  • 1/4 teaspoon red pepper flakes
  • 1 can crushed tomatoes (29 ounce can)
  • 1 quart chicken broth
  • 1/4 cup fresh basil
Directions
Preheat oven to 400 degrees F.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.

Halve the tomatoes and place on the prepared baking sheet. Drizzle with 1 tablespoon olive oil and season with salt and pepper. Bake for 45 minutes.

In a large saucepan, heat remaining olive oil and butter. Sauté onion, garlic and red pepper flakes until onions start to brown, approximately 20 minutes.

Stir remaining ingredients including roasted tomatoes and juice in pan. Simmer for 30 minutes, stirring frequently.

Pour into food processor and puree until smooth. Pour back into pan until ready to serve.

Crispy Soft Broccoli Recipe

Submitted by RecipeTips.com
Who would have thought that just 3 ingredients could be so delicious? And all you have to do is through them together an put it in the oven. This will be your new go to vegetable since the broccoli is so simple.
Crispy Soft Broccoli Recipe
Ingredients
  • 1 bunch broccoli
  • 3 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1/2 teaspoon garlic salt, or to desired taste
Directions
  • Preheat oven to 375° F (350° F for a 12" Dutch oven).
  • Cut broccoli florets leaving a portion of the stem with each floret. Place in baking dish or 12" Dutch oven.
  • Coat broccoli with olive oil and sprinkle with garlic salt. Place the cover on the baking dish or cover with foil.
  • Place covered dish in the oven and cook for 20-30 minutes. Check for doneness after 15 minutes to be sure you do not overcook the broccoli. It should be crisp-tender when done. Cooking time will vary depending on the amount of broccoli and your personal taste.
  • Remove from heat and transfer to serving dish.
NOTE: This is the easiest side dish to make and I have people devouring large quantities who say they would never touch broccoli. Be sure when you are adding the garlic salt to use your own judgment on how much to use. That will also depend on how much broccoli you are actually preparing.

Braided Golden Potato Bread Recipe

Submitted by RecipeTips.com
A pretty braided bread to serve at any meal. This flavorful, crispy crust, potato bread makes a perfect side to serve with soup, chili, and stew, or as an accompaniment to a meat and potato meal. It also is great dipping bread for many savory type dips.
Braided Golden Potato Bread Recipe
PREP: 1 hour
COOK: 30 minutes
READY IN: 1.5 hours
Container: large cookie sheet
Ingredients
  • 1 large Yukon Gold potato
  • 1 small onion
  • 1 egg
  • 2 tablespoons butter - softened
  • 1 tablespoon honey or light corn syrup
  • 1/4 cup grated Parmesan
  • 1/4 cup chopped fresh parsley
  • 1 1/2 teaspoons sal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on pepper
  • 1 package yeast - dry active, 1/4 oz.
  • 1 cup milk - warmed to 70 - 80 degrees
  • 4 cups bread flour
  • TOPPING:
  • 1 egg - beat lightly for egg wash
  • Extra parmesan cheese
Directions
  • Peel and cut potato into cubes. Chop the onion and place it in a small saucepan with the potato cubes. Cover with water and bring to a boil. Reduce the heat once it is boiling; then cover and simmer until potatoes soft when poked with a fork (10 to 15 minutes).
  • Drain the water off and then mash the potatoes and onions together until smooth; set aside. (Note: you need about 3/4 cup of mashed potatoes & onions to add to this recipe.)
  • In a large mixing bowl, combine the egg, butter, honey or syrup, cheese, parsley, salt, pepper, yeast (dry-do not mix with water), warm milk, mashed potato mixture, and 3 cups of flour. Mix all ingredients together until well mixed.
  • Add enough of the remaining cup of flour to make the dough just stiff enough to be able to knead. Mix in with hands if necessary.
  • When just stiff enough to knead, place the dough on a lightly floured surface and knead the bread for approximately 8 minutes.
  • When done kneading, divide the dough into 3 even sections. Working on the floured surface, roll and form each section into an 18" long rope.
  • Place the 3 ropes on a large greased baking sheet. Gather the 3 ropes at one end and then begin to braid the sections together. When you have the entire loaf braided, pinch each end together and tuck under.
  • Cover the loaf with a light kitchen towel and place the loaf in a warm place to rise. Allow the loaf to rise to double in size. This should take approximately 60 minutes, depending on how warm the area is where it is place.
  • Once the loaf has double in size, brush the top with the egg wash and sprinkle with extra parmesan cheese.
  • Preheat oven to 350° F. and bake for 30 to 35 minutes or until it is a nice golden brown.
  • When done, remove it from the baking sheet immediately and place on a cooling rack.
  • When cooled, it is ready to slice and serve.

Apple Spice Bundt Cake Recipe

Submitted by RecipeTips.com
Made with shredded apples, this spiced bundt cake has a moist, dense texture and is loaded with flavor. This bundt cake recipe is a delicious way to enjoy the fall harvest of apples.
Apple Spice Bundt Cake Recipe
PREP: 1 hour
COOK: 1 minute
READY IN: 2 hours
Servings:
Change Servings
Ingredients
  • CAKE:
  • 3 1/2 cups flour
  • 1 1/2 teaspoons baking soda
  • 4 teaspoons cinnamon
  • 1 teaspoon cloves
  • 1 teaspoon nutmeg
  • 1 1/4 teaspoons salt
  • 1 cup butter - softened
  • 1 1/2 cups granulated sugar
  • 1 1/2 cups light brown sugar
  • 4 eggs
  • 2 teaspoons vanilla
  • 1 1/2 cups buttermilk
  • 4 medium tart apples, peeled and shredded
  • GLAZE:
  • 2 tablespoons butter - softened
  • 1/2 cup powdered sugar
  • 2 tablespoons maple syrup
  • 1/4 cup chopped pecans
Directions
CAKE:
  • Butter the inside of a 9-inch bundt pan; flour lightly. Preheat the oven to 350 degrees.
  • Combine the flour, baking soda, cinnamon, cloves, nutmeg, and salt in a bowl and whisk together.
  • In a large mixing bowl, cream the butter, granulated sugar and brown sugar together.
  • With the mixer on low, begin adding the eggs one at a time; beat until all eggs are mixed in. Add the vanilla and beat just until combined.
  • Mix in half the buttermilk and half the flour mixture with the mixer on low. Add the remaining buttermilk and flour mixture and beat on low just until flour is mixed in.
  • Stir in the shredded apples. The cake batter will be very thick.
  • Spread the batter evenly in the prepared bundt pan. The pan will be very full so you may want to place it on a cookie sheet to catch any overflow of batter that may occur during baking.
  • Bake for 1 hour. Check for doneness by poking middle with a toothpick. The toothpick will come out clean when the cake is done.
  • Place the cake on a rack to cool for 10 minutes before removing from the pan. Turn cake out carefully onto a wire rack to cool completely.
GLAZE:
  • Whisk the butter and powdered sugar together until smooth.
  • Whisk in the maple syrup until well blended; set aside at room temperature until ready to use.
  • Drizzle over the cake when it has completely cooled.
  • Sprinkle chopped nuts over glaze before it sets up.

Note: This cake is very heavy and dense. For a less dense cake you could try adding only 3 shredded apples rather than 4 if you prefer.
